DentalBytes ep. 153 "Wayne Rees: Saving Lives with VELscope"
Send us Fan MailIn this powerful and purpose-driven episode, host Marc Wagner welcomes Wayne Rees, a long-time innovator in dental imaging and the driving force behind the VELscope oral cancer screening system. With over 35,000 units in operation globally, VELscope is transforming how dental practices detect early signs of oral cancer, dysplasia, bacterial load, periodontal disease, and even signs of sleep apnea—using a safe, blue light fluorescence system.Wayne shares how his journey began over 35 years ago in imaging technology, leading to his current mission: helping clinicians catch disease early and save lives. From partnering with the BC Cancer Agency to collaborating with specialists like Dr. Samson Ng and Dr. Edmund Truelove, Wayne and his team have developed a next-generation VELscope featuring surgical white light, polarized light for clearer images, and seamless integration with mobile devices and second-opinion platforms like OralMedicine.com.🔍 Key Topics Covered:VELscope’s clinical evolution and why it’s more than just a cancer detector—it’s a visual guide to better diagnosis.How the blue light fluorescence works by identifying non-fluorescent (dark) areas that may signal pathology.Why annual oral cancer screening (or more for high-risk patients) is vital—and how most practices are still falling short.The growing role of HPV (types 16 & 18) in oral cancer and how rising case numbers (60,000/year in North America) demand proactive care.New use cases: VELscope for margin delineation during tumor removal surgery, confirmed by BC Cancer’s five-year, double-blinded study.Real-world success stories where VELscope literally helped save lives—including cases where seasoned dentists discovered oral cancer in their patients for the first time.The push toward AI-powered diagnostics, with collaborative efforts underway with University of Washington and BC Cancer Agency.Support the showThanks so much for watching and being part of the Dentist on Demand community—your support means everything. DentalBytes ep. 120 "Patient Relationship Management" Dr. Dennis Marangos
Send us Fan MailIn the latest episode of DentalBytes, host Marc T. Wagner sits down with veteran dentist Dr. Dennis Marangos to delve into the essential strategies for practice growth. This insightful discussion covers the critical importance of understanding your practice's numbers and building robust systems to support sustainable growth.Dr. Marangos emphasizes that a solo dental practice can thrive with a patient base of 1,500, provided these patients receive exceptional care. But what does exceptional care entail? It means truly understanding each patient and becoming a partner in their oral health journey. This requires maintaining detailed records to cater to the unique needs and characteristics of each individual, as dentistry is far from a "one size fits all" profession.Effective patient relationship management also involves recognizing the diverse communication styles of patients and tailoring interactions accordingly. While acquiring new patients is crucial, it only contributes to about 10% of practice growth. The real growth lies in expanding your scope of practice through continued education, embracing the latest technology, and incorporating innovative tools both in the front office and the operatory.Dr. Marangos also highlights the importance of investing in the knowledge and skills of both yourself and your team. A well-trained and happy team is key to retaining long-term patients and ensuring their satisfaction.
